Managing Rain Ingress and Seal Failures in Louvred Pergolas

A louvred roof is designed to be water-resistant, directing rain into internal gutters via interlocking blades. However, ingress can occur if the EPDM gaskets perish, the blades are misaligned, or the drainage capacity is exceeded. Unlike a fixed glass roof, a louvred system has hundreds of metres of potential seal interfaces. Understanding how these seals compress and how water behaves during the transition from blade to gutter is key to diagnosing and fixing leaks.

Gasket Compression and Elasticity

Each louvre blade is fitted with a flexible gasket that creates a seal with the adjacent blade. Over years of exposure to UV and extreme temperatures, these gaskets can lose their elasticity or 'set' in a compressed shape. If the gaskets do not spring back, they fail to create a watertight barrier. Replacing these seals or adjusting the motor tension to increase compression can often resolve persistent drips.

Never use petroleum-based lubricants on rubber gaskets as they cause the material to perish.

The 'First Drop' Effect

When you open a louvred roof after rain, water can sometimes drip onto the patio. This is often mistaken for a leak. If the blades are not designed with a 'dry-opening' feature, the surface tension holds water on the edge of the blade, which then drops as the angle changes. High-quality systems use a specific blade profile to ensure this water is channeled back into the gutters even during the opening cycle.

Gutter-to-Post Transition Leaks

The most common point for true ingress is at the corners where the horizontal perimeter gutters meet the vertical downpipes. These joints rely on high-grade sealants or mechanical gaskets. If the structure has settled or if the sealant has pulled away due to thermal expansion, water can bypass the downpipe and run down the inside of the frame or even drip from the ceiling-side of the beam.

  • Inspect corner mitres for visible sealant gaps
  • Check the 'leaf trap' at the downpipe entry
  • Ensure the roof is perfectly level (or has the correct fall)
  • Look for 'tracking' water marks along the internal beams

Questions we get asked on repair calls

Is a louvred roof 100% waterproof?

They are designed to be 'watertight' under normal conditions, but because they are made of moving parts, they are not technically a 'hermetically sealed' structure like a conservatory roof.

Why is water dripping from the motor housing?

This is a serious issue that suggests water is tracking along the drive rail or through the wiring loom. It should be inspected immediately to prevent electrical failure.

Can the seals be replaced without taking the roof apart?

In most modern systems, the gaskets are 'push-fit' into a groove on the blade and can be replaced while the blades are in the vertical position.

Does the pitch of the roof affect the seals?

Yes. Even 'flat' louvred roofs are usually built with a tiny internal fall. If the structure has shifted and is now 'back-falling', water will pool on the blades instead of running into the gutters.

Wind-Driven Ingress and Overspill

In extreme Yorkshire weather, wind can force water uphill or over the upstands of the internal gutters. This 'forced ingress' is a physical limit of any moving roof system. However, if it happens in moderate rain, it usually suggests the gutters are partially blocked, causing the water level to rise until it spills over the internal 'dam' wall and into the area below.

  1. 1Clear the perimeter gutters of all organic debris
  2. 2Verify the downpipes are not backed up (causing the gutters to fill)
  3. 3Check the blade pitch to ensure water is shed rapidly
  4. 4Consider side-screens to reduce wind-driven rain penetration
